Scientific developments in agriculture and technologies of chemical fertilizers and pesticides fed the green revolution of the mid-20th century. Still, a few decades later, pollution and toxins from those chemicals became evident. Now, climate change, partially caused by agricultural technologies, has also moved to the centre of our preoccupations. These environmental problems, as well as economic and social inequities, incentivize the search for more sustainable agricultural technologies that can be brought about by deeper scientific insight. Replacing chemical fertilizers with less harmful products, which we can refer to as organic fertilizers, while still maintaining crop production capable of feeding the global population, is an objective for farmers, policymakers, and, in fact, for everyone. In today's world, science and technology move forward rapidly, pervading every aspect of social and individual lives; keeping in touch with them is necessary for each of us in our field of work. This book aims to help us replace chemical fertilizers with organic ones. In the following chapters, the reader can find reviews of recent developments and reports of experimental works on organic fertilizers that might help better understand their advantages and drawbacks.
